Secondary Concentrations in Marketing
No matter what your major, you can add a marketing concentration to your Gabelli School degree.
The Fordham marketing faculty has created three secondary concentrations that any business student may pursue—regardless of major. They are:
- Marketing Analytics
- Strategic Branding
- Services Marketing
Earning one of these can help to position you for jobs in marketing research, marketing analytics, branding, advertising, or service-related fields such as financial services and retailing. Each requires only three specific courses as outlined below, for a total of 9 credits.
Required courses
Marketing Analytics
- Marketing Analytics
- Data-Driven Marketing Decisions
- Web Analytics (IS course)
Strategic Branding
- Branding
- Revealing Consumer Insights
- Marketing Analytics
Services Marketing
- Services Marketing
- Financial Services Marketing
- Customer Experience Management
Please note: MKBU 3225 Marketing Principles is a prerequisite for all of the above courses, and therefore must be taken before beginning one of the concentrations.
